About

Shamik Aikat is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Shamik Aikat has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 303 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 4 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Shamik Aikat's work include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(6 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(4 papers) and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(4 papers). Shamik Aikat is often cited by papers focused on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(6 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(4 papers) and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(4 papers). Shamik Aikat collaborates with scholars based in United States. Shamik Aikat's co-authors include Edgar Lichstein, Saurav Chatterjee, Debabrata Mukherjee, Partha Sardar, Joydeep Ghosh, Wen‐Chih Wu, Sun Moon Kim, Alison Bailey, Abhishek Sharma and Sandeep Goyal and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American College of Cardiology, PLoS ONE and CHEST Journal.
